PROFIBUS转PROFINET借网关模块攻克PROFIBUS仪表和西门子PLC的协议转换难题

电子说

1.3w人已加入

描述

一、项目背景

  在当今竞争激烈的工业生产领域,设备间的高效通讯已成为提升生产效率、确保产品质量的核心要素。以一家颇具规模的制造企业为例,其生产线的控制系统以西门子1516PLC为核心,凭借其强大的运算与控制能力,精准调控生产流程的各个环节。与此同时,用于实时监测生产过程关键参数的奇石乐仪表,因配备PROFIBUS DP通讯接口,在数据交互上却与采用Profinet协议的西门子 1516PLC形成了壁垒。


  这一通讯协议的差异,如同在两者之间竖起了一道屏障,致使生产数据的实时采集与控制指令的及时传达受阻,极大地限制了生产线的自动化协同效能,无法满足智能化生产对数据及时性、准确性的严苛要求。


  为突破这一困境,该企业经多方调研与测试,引入了捷米特JM-DPM-PN网关模块。此网关模块宛如一座桥梁,巧妙地化解了Profinet从站与PROFIBUS DP协议之间的转换难题,成功打通了西门子1516PLC与奇石乐仪表的数据交互通道,有力推动了生产线的高效运行。

Profinet

二、技术参数

1.  PROFIBUS DP 主站参数

o 支持标准的 PROFIBUS DP V0、V1 协议。

o 自动波特率检测,支持波特率范围为 9.6K、19.2K、45.45K、93.75K、187.5K、500K、1.5M、3M、6M、12M。

o 最大可连接 32 个 PROFIBUS DP 从站。

o 单个 DP 从站通讯数据不超过 244 个字节。

o 从站允许最大用户参数长度 244 字节。

2. Profinet 从站参数

o 支持标准的 ProfiNet I/O 协议。

o 以太网接口为 10/100M 自适应,RJ45 接口,支持以太网供电(可选)。

o 支持最大输入字节数为 1440 字节,最大输出字节为 1440 字节。

3. 支持标准的 PROFINET I/O 协议。

4. PROFINET 支持的最多16个槽位,支持最大的输入字节数为1440字节,最大的输出字节为1440字节,输入输出字节的长度由 TIA Portal 设定

5. 支持的模块类型:


 

001 byte Input 032 Dword input 004 Dword Output
001 word Input 064 Dword input 008 Dword Output
001 Dword input 128 Dword input 016 Dword Output
002 Dword input 001 byte Output 032 Dword Output
004 Dword input 001 word Output 064 Dword Output
008 Dword input 001 Dword Output 128 Dword Output
016 Dword input 002 Dword Output  

6. 在 PROFIBUS 侧,该设备集成了PROFIBUS DP 主站接口,PROFIBUS DP 网络组态由配置软件完成,最多支持 125 个从站;

7. 电气参数

o 供电:DC 24V(±5%),最大功率 3.5W。

o 工作温度:-40℃~85℃。

o 防护等级:IP20。

o 安装方式:DIN-35mm 导轨安装。

ProfinetProfinet

三、项目实施过程

(一)设备连接

1.利用网线将捷米特JM-DPM-PN网关的Profinet接口与西门子1516PLC的Profinet端口进行连接。

2.使用PROFIBUSDP电缆把捷米特JM-DPM-PN网关的PROFIBUSDP主站接口连接到奇石乐仪表的PROFIBUSDP从站接口。

3.为捷米特JM-DPM-PN网关接入稳定的24V直流电源。

(二)Profinet侧配置(以西门子TIAPortal软件为例)

1.创建项目与添加设备

-打开西门子TIAPortal软件,点击“创建新项目”,为项目命名并选择合适的保存路径。

-在项目视图中,右键点击“设备和网络”,选择“添加新设备”,在设备列表中找到并添加西门子1516PLC设备。

Profinet

2.导入GSD文件并添加网关

-导入网关网关的GSD文件。

Profinet

-在TIAPortal软件中,点击“选项”-“管理通用站描述文件(GSD)”,在弹出的窗口中点击“安装”,选择下载好的GSD文件进行导入。

Profinet

-导入成功后,在硬件目录中找到捷米特JM-DPM-PN网关设备,将其拖拽到网络视图中,与西门子1516PLC建立连接。

3.配置网关IP地址与设备名称

-选中捷米特JM-DPM-PN网关设备,在属性窗口中找到“以太网地址”选项卡。

-根据实际网络情况,为网关配置一个与西门子1516PLC在同一网段的IP地址,同时设置合适的子网掩码。

-在“设备名称”选项中,为网关设置一个易于识别的名称,方便后续管理和监控。

4.分配输入输出数据地址

-双击捷米特JM-DPM-PN网关设备,进入设备组态界面。

-根据生产需求,在“输入”和“输出”区域分别分配合适的数据地址。可以通过右键点击相应区域,选择“添加新的连接”,然后设置数据长度和数据类型。例如,如果需要传输电路板检测的电压数据,可以选择合适的字节长度和数据类型(如整数型)。

Profinet

(三)PROFIBUSDP侧配置

1.连接配置软件

-通过USB或以太网接口,使用捷米特提供的配置软件连接到捷米特JM-DPM-PN网关。在连接前,确保网关已正确上电且网络连接正常。

2.设置PROFIBUSDP主站参数

-打开配置软件后,在软件界面中找到“PROFIBUSDP主站设置”选项。

-选择合适的波特率,根据实际通讯需求和设备性能,可在9.6K-12M的范围内进行选择。一般情况下,如果通讯距离较短且数据量较大,可选择较高的波特率;如果通讯距离较长或设备对通讯稳定性要求较高,可选择较低的波特率。

-设置从站地址,每个连接到PROFIBUSDP网络的从站设备都需要有一个唯一的地址。根据奇石乐仪表的设备手册,为其分配一个合适的从站地址。

3.扫描并添加从站设备

-在配置软件中点击“扫描网络”按钮,软件将自动搜索PROFIBUSDP网络上的所有设备。

-扫描完成后,在设备列表中找到奇石乐仪表设备,点击“添加”按钮,将其添加到捷米特JM-DPM-PN网关的从站列表中。

4.配置数据映射

-选中已添加的奇石乐仪表设备,在配置软件中找到“数据映射”选项。

-根据西门子1516PLC侧的输入输出数据地址和数据类型,配置奇石乐仪表的输入输出数据映射。例如,如果西门子1516PLC需要接收奇石乐仪表检测的电路板电阻值数据,在数据映射中设置将仪表的电阻值数据映射到相应的输入地址。确保数据映射的逻辑与实际生产需求一致,以实现准确的数据交互。

四、应用效果

Profinet

五、项目总结

在电子制造行业中, 捷米特PROFIBUSDP主站转Profinet从站网关模块凭借其强大的功能和稳定的性能,成功解决了不同协议设备之间的通讯难题。该网关的应用不仅提升了产品质量和生产效率,还为企业实现智能化生产和数字化管理奠定了坚实的基础。


审核编辑 黄宇
 

打开APP阅读更多精彩内容
声明:本文内容及配图由入驻作者撰写或者入驻合作网站授权转载。文章观点仅代表作者本人,不代表电子发烧友网立场。文章及其配图仅供工程师学习之用,如有内容侵权或者其他违规问题,请联系本站处理。 举报投诉

全部0条评论

快来发表一下你的评论吧 !

×
20
完善资料,
赚取积分